My old Trumpet Vine that reached the second story and started to grow into my daughters bedroom through a crack in the her window frame, didn't seem to bother the cement sidewalk that ran next to it. I think the sidewalk kept it from spreading all over the place. It just grew up and not out. It was still a beast and I wouldn't have another one.
